Psyllium husk (Plantago ovata) is the world's most widely used dietary fiber supplement ingredient, best known as the active component in Metamucil. India dominates global production with over 80% market share, grown primarily in the semi-arid regions of Rajasthan and Gujarat. The FDA recognizes psyllium's cholesterol-lowering benefits, allowing a heart health claim for products containing 7g daily.
Prices have surged approximately 52% in recent years, reaching around $6,600/MT, driven by the health food boom, growing demand for fiber-enriched processed foods, the gut health movement, and interest in natural GLP-1 alternatives. Supply remains constrained by the limited growing area in western India and the crop's sensitivity to rainfall timing.

Key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Purity | 85%, 95%, or 98% husk |
| Swell Volume | > 40 ml/g (USP specification) |
| Moisture | < 12% |
| Ash | < 4% |
| Price | ~$6,600/MT (85% husk, FOB) |
| Certifications | USP/BP, Organic (USDA/EU), Kosher, Halal |
| MOQ | 1 FCL (~15 MT) |
| HS Code | 1211.90 |
